WebOct 4, 2024 · Occasionally, electron counts can be as low as eight electrons. These cases often occur in early transition metals, such as titanium or tantalum. These metals have a long way to go to get to eighteen electrons, and sometimes they cannot fit that many ligands in their "coordination sphere". http://www.chem4kids.com/files/elements/022_shells.html WebPeriodic Trends in the Oxidation States of Elements. 1. Variation Of Oxidation State Along a Period. While moving left to right across a period, the number of valence electrons of elements increases and varies between 1 to 8. But the valency of elements, when combined with H or O first, increases from 1 to 4 and then it reduces to zero.
